#9b2e2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b2e2e is composed of 60.8% red, 18%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.3%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#9b2e2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c5c with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#9b2e2e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9b2e2e has RGB values of R:155, G:46,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.7,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10169902.

Hex triplet 9b2e2e #9b2e2e
RGB Decimal 155, 46, 46 rgb(155,46,46)
RGB Percent 60.8, 18, 18 rgb(60.8%,18%,18%)
CMYK 0, 70, 70, 39
HSL 0°, 54.2, 39.4 hsl(0,54.2%,39.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 0°, 70.3, 60.8
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 36.217, 45.057, 26.101
XYZ 14.988, 9.121, 3.556
xyY 0.542, 0.33, 9.121
CIE-LCH 36.217, 52.071, 30.083
CIE-LUV 36.217, 80.582, 17.383
Hunter-Lab 30.202, 35.732, 14.16
Binary 10011011, 00101110, 00101110

Shades and Tints of #9b2e2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b2e2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656464 is the less saturated color, while #c20707 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9b2e2e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#4f4f4f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#5e4848 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#645d45 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#725931 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a0383b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#784c3c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#814930 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9e3436 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
